From ancient times, the dialogue was considered one of the main forms of detection of truth.
The art of raising the question and the skill of answering uncomfortable attacks has always been considered the main advantage of preachers, sophists and philosophers.
For science, which built all the argument exclusively around experimental practice, the spaces of dialogue seemed alien to the stereotypically, and the main character in science was a hero of a loner, gnawing a stone of knowledge in the silence of a laboratory or office.
The book offered to your attention does not leave a stone on a stone from this stereotype. Science is, first of all, the space of dialogue.
There is always a place for fierce disputes, passions and even politics.
Science, primarily polemic - with teachers and students, friends and enemies, with opponents and supporters.
Science begins with doubt, blooms where there is a problem, and never gives final answers.
This is the struggle of hypotheses for the right to become theories, it is a constant conflict and polemic. Such is the real science and such is the fate of the main author of this book - Lev Samuilovich Klein (36 dialogue participants - 36).
This is the final presentation of the views of an extraordinary scientist and theorist, a person who, despite world fame and very venerable age, is constantly open to dialogue
